- Physical Description
- ca.19 cm of textual records. -- ca.300 photographs : prints, negatives. -- 1 motion picture.
- Scope & Content
- -- James Irvine Brewster, 1882-1947, came to Banff with his parents in 1888. While still boys, he and his brother Bill started guiding fishing parties and later formed an outfitting partnership. With silent partners Fred Hussey and Phil Moore, they established Brewster Brothers in 1904. Jim Brewster and Hussey left the business in 1906. In 1909, Jim returned to guide the business. Under his control, it became a major transportation supplier, Brewster Transport Company. -- Series consists of: A. Professional papers and photographs, ca.12 cm of textual records, ca.240 photographs, 1 motion picture; B. Other papers and photographs, before 1948, ca.5 cm of textual records, ca.60 photographs. Series pertains mainly to guiding and outfitting activities, and to Brewster Transport Company records, including Sunshine ski area records. Professional papers and photographs sub-series includes correspondence, diaries, legal papers, Sunshine Lodge addition papers, Brewster house plans and other material. Correspondence is incoming and outgoing letters between Brewster and Hussey, clients, and associates regarding guiding and outfitting, real estate speculation and personal matters, etc. 1906-1907. Diaries pertain to guiding, hunting and horse trips, 1897-1901, 1904-1906; entries mainly record clients, territory covered and game observations and records. Also includes articles and hand-drawn map by Brewster on hunting, 1903-1906. Includes 54 photographs pertaining to Brewster Transport after Jim Brewster period. -- Title based on contents of series. -- File descriptions available in this database.
